To your right, across the street at 28a is Kollenburg brewery. Cross the street and head over to it.
You look into the shop window of a city brewery and a beer shop in one. The Kollenburg city brewery is part of one organization that consists of three companies. Together with the café ‘Bar le Duc’, which is just around the corner and Bistro ‘la Duchesse’, which is located on the first floor of the building, they make all beers with the name Kolleke. The brewery was founded in 1999 by father and son Kollenburg. Initially the beers were brewed elsewhere, but in 2004 a brewing equipment from Hungary was installed. Thus, in September 2007, the official opening of brewery ‘t Kolleke took place. The building, here at number 28 Kruisstraat, dates from the middle of the 19th century and has borne names such as ‘de Kemel’ and ‘de Hopzak’.
It is connected via a passage to the Bar le Duc café, which is located in a building whose walls and the cellar were built in the Middle Ages. This café offers an assortment of no less than 130 specialty beers.
